Atlassian uses cookies to improve your browsing experience, perform analytics and research, and conduct advertising. Accept all cookies to indicate that you agree to our use of cookies on your device. Atlassian cookies and tracking notice, (opens new window)
Directcall
/
Dados personalizados no extrato
Updated mar. 12

    Dados personalizados no extrato

    Para que serve este recurso:

    Se você associar dados da sua aplicação nos extratos da Directcall (ex. CPF ou NOME do seu cliente), isso vai facilitar a localização do histórico de ligações e mensagens nos relatórios online da sua aplicação, pelo CPF ou pelo NOME do seu cliente.

    Como associar informações no extrato 

    Veja aqui como você pode associar algum tipo de informação em uma chamada, SMS ou mensagem de voz enviado.

    Parâmetro

    Chave

    Valor

    Parâmetro

    Chave

    Valor

    campos

    {sua chave ou nome}

    {informação a ser salva}

    Como utilizar?

    Digamos que você queira enviar alguns dados adicionais ao realizar uma chamada através da API Directcall. Quer informar o Nome e o CPF do cliente e, posteriormente, consultar estes dados. Ao enviar o Parâmetro contendo a chave e o valor necessário, é possível consultar no extrato de chamadas as informações enviadas. Veja o exemplo de envio com os dados de Nome e CPF:

    Exemplo de chamada com informação associada
    curl -X POST https://api.directcallsoft.com/voz/call \ --data-urlencode "access_token={token}" \ --data-urlencode "origem={origem}" \ --data-urlencode "destino={destino}" \ --data-urlencode "gravar={gravar}" \ --data-urlencode "format={format}" \ --data-urlencode "campos[nome]=João da Silva" \ --data-urlencode "campos[CPF]=000.000.000-00"

     

    Desta forma estamos associando os parâmetros enviados, Nome e CPF, a chamada e podem ser consultados através do extrato, como um filtro. Veja o exemplo:

    Exemplo de extrato com informação associada
    curl -X POST https://api.directcallsoft.com/extrato/list \ --data-urlencode "access_token={token}" \ --data-urlencode "dataInicial={datainicial}" \ --data-urlencode "dataFinal={datafinal}" \ --data-urlencode "numeroOrigem={numeroOrigem}" \ --data-urlencode "numeroDestino={numeroDestino}" \ --data-urlencode "formato={format}" \ --data-urlencode "campos[CPF]=000.000.000-00"

     

    Quais funcionalidades podem utilizar os dados personalizados?

    • Chamadas

    • Chamadas Gravadas

    • Envio de SMS (Com short number)

    • Envio de mensagem de voz

    Em quais extratos poderei filtrar os dados personalizados?

    • Chamadas

    • Chamadas Gravadas

    • Envio de SMS (Com short number)

    • Envio de mensagem de voz

    ( * ) Estas informações vão estar disponíveis pelo prazo vigente do extrato.

     

    get_gravacoes.sh

     

    Bem-vindo à Área de Desenvolvedores
    Teams
    , (opens new window)

    Directcall APIs Telefonia - Voz, Gravação, Extratos, SMS
    • Directcall APIs Telecom
      Directcall APIs Telecom
       This trigger is hidden
    • Directcall APPs Telefonia
      Directcall APPs Telefonia
       This trigger is hidden
    Results will update as you type.
    • APIs para Ligar, Ligar e gravar
      • Remover chamada agendada
      • Agendar chamada, gravar
      • Status de chamada agendada
      • Consultar o status de uma chamada
      • Iniciar uma chamada, gravar
      • Finalizar uma chamada
      • Dados personalizados no extrato
      • APIs de Callback para receber avisos de ligações recebidas e
    • APIs para enviar SMS, receber
    • API Contatos
    • PLUGIN para Ligar, Ligar e gravar (JQuery)
    • APIs para consultar PORTABILIDADE TELEFÔNICA
    • API para solicitar online linhas telefônicas gratuitas na Directcall.
    • APIs para consultar Saldo de Teste Gratuito
    • APIs - Códigos de retorno ou de erro
    • APIs para consultar Saldo de Contas Pré-pagas
    • APIs - Método de autenticação
    • APIs Contratar números
    • APIs para gerenciar Nº de telefone (DID)
    • APIs para Mensagem de voz
    • APIs - Notas gerais
    • APIs para Extrato, Ouvir ligação gravada
    • APPs para sistemas Desktop e Web
      You‘re viewing this with anonymous access, so some content might be blocked.
      {"serverDuration": 10, "requestCorrelationId": "fae9957912ae4bb1b7ef59417bc4fc94"}